Actor Gary Holton died before some of the final indoor scenes were filmed, and the scripts had to be reworked to explain Wayne's absence from these indoor scenes. There were viewer complaints about the editing, and after a few weeks Thames and TVS both opted out of the run and instead showed the original uncut episodes at 10.30pm on Mondays. The "building site" used for most of the filming was a set created on the backlot of the former ATV Elstree Studios at Borehamwood in Hertfordshire (then owned by Central). The episode titled "Marjorie Doesn't Live Here Anymore", which Clement and La Frenais described as their favourite in the second series because it was "drab and grey looking", and "added some meat to Oz's character", was not only the most watched episode of the show's run but drew in the highest audience percentage out of all the channels on the night of its screening, with sixteen million viewers. Made at the height of the AIDS epidemic, it consists of Northern Life presenter Paul Frost and Dr. Peter Jones, director of the Haemophilia Centre in Newcastle, discussing HIV/AIDS transmission and prevention in a TV studio, but cuts back and forth to a skit set in a pub, where Dennis and Oz are watching the broadcast, and are themselves discussing the issues over a pint of beer. [citation needed] In his autobiography, Nail said he was glad to be done with filming not just because of Holton's death but because he felt the second series lacked the gritty edge of the first series, something Dick Clement and Ian La Frenais later said they agreed with.
